Aishwarya Rai Bachchan is one of the most popular and influential celebrities in India through her successful acting career. Winning the 1994 pageant, she is often cited as “the most beautiful woman in the world”. The actress enjoys a huge fan base not just in India but throughout the world.
Aishwarya‘s radiant beauty enchanted millions across the world but the Netherlands decided to honour her by naming a variety of exotic tulip flowers after her.
As per Telegraph India, managing director of the Netherlands Board of Tourism and Conventions Hans Van Driem in 2005 announced, “The tulip represents all the beautiful things of Holland and no one’s more beautiful here today than Aishwarya Rai.”
